1.1 Macroeconomic Variables: What They Mean and Why They Matter
You should be able to define and explain (not just memorize) core variables:
- Gross Domestic Product (GDP)
Measures the value of goods and services produced within a country’s borders in a given period. - Real GDP vs Nominal GDP
- Nominal GDP uses current prices.
- Real GDP adjusts for inflation using a price index.
- Inflation (often measured by CPI or similar indices)
The general rise in prices reduces purchasing power. - Unemployment rate
Percentage of the labour force that is unemployed and actively seeking work (definitions matter). - Interest rate
The cost of borrowing and reward for saving; affects investment, consumption, exchange rates. - Exchange rate
The price of one currency in terms of another; affects imports/exports and inflation.
Why these matter for exam questions: almost every policy argument (e.g., “tighten monetary policy”) is justified using expected changes in inflation, output, employment, and exchange rates.
Common exam trap: confusing “change in GDP” with “level of GDP”
- A country may have high GDP but slow GDP growth.
- A country may experience inflation but still have real growth if production expands faster than prices.
1.2 Measuring Output: GDP, National Income, and Circular Flow Logic
GDP and the Production Boundary
GDP counts final goods and services. Intermediate goods are not counted to avoid double counting.
A typical macro exam may ask you to distinguish:
- Final consumption expenditure (C)
- Investment (I)
- Government purchases (G)
- Net exports (NX = exports − imports)
So the basic expenditure identity is:
[
GDP = C + I + G + (X – M)
]

1.4 Business Cycles and Long-Run vs Short-Run Thinking
A country can be:
- In recession: output below potential, unemployment rises
- Booming: output above potential, inflation pressure increases
This leads to an essential macro distinction:
- Short-run macro emphasizes sticky prices/wages, demand shocks, and policy stabilization.
- Long-run macro emphasizes supply-side growth determinants: productivity, capital accumulation, labour force growth, technology.
Exam tasks may involve identifying whether a scenario is:
- a demand shock (e.g., sudden fall in consumption),
- a supply shock (e.g., oil price shock),
- or a policy shock.
1.5 Aggregate Demand and Aggregate Supply (AD-AS): Building Blocks
You typically learn AD-AS first because it provides the structure for policy impacts.
Aggregate Demand (AD)
AD is the total quantity of goods and services demanded at different price levels.
Common components:
- Consumption (C): influenced by income, confidence, interest rates
- Investment (I): sensitive to real interest rates and expected returns
- Government spending (G): policy-driven
- Net exports (NX): depends on exchange rate and global demand
Aggregate Supply (AS)
AS relates output to price level.
- Short-run AS: often upward sloping due to wage/price stickiness and adjustment delays.
- Long-run AS: often vertical at potential output in classical models, representing output determined by real factors.
Shocks and policy response
- A demand shock shifting AD left/right impacts output and inflation.
- Policy can shift AD (fiscal/monetary) and indirectly affect expected inflation and supply behavior.
1.6 A Worked Scenario (Exam-Style): Identifying the Macro Shock
Consider a hypothetical economy where:
- global commodity prices rise sharply (e.g., imported fuel and raw materials get more expensive),
- firms face higher costs,
- transport and production costs increase,
- firms raise prices to maintain margins.
Likely classification: a negative supply shock (cost-push).
Expected macro outcome (short-run):
- Output falls (or growth slows) due to higher costs
- Inflation rises due to higher costs
Why this matters: students often incorrectly assume that “inflation always means demand is too high.” In supply shock cases, inflation can rise even when demand weakens.

2.1 Fiscal Policy: Tools, Budget Concepts, and Multipliers
Fiscal policy definition
Fiscal policy refers to changes in:
- government spending (G),
- taxation (T),
- and sometimes transfer payments.
Budget balance and sustainability
You should understand:
- Budget deficit: spending exceeds revenues
- Budget surplus: revenues exceed spending
A critical macro concern: continuous deficits can raise debt and interest burdens, which can constrain future fiscal policy.
The fiscal multiplier idea
The multiplier captures how an initial spending change affects equilibrium output.
- If government spending rises by a certain amount, firms hire more workers, incomes rise, consumption increases, leading to further increases in output.
- Taxes can reduce disposable income and dampen consumption.
Exam tasks often ask:
- “Explain how an increase in government spending can increase GDP.”
- “What is the role of taxes in the fiscal multiplier?”
Crowding out (counter-argument)
In some models, increased government spending can:
- raise interest rates,
- attract capital,
- reduce private investment (crowding out).
This leads to an important “balanced answer” strategy:
- In the presence of slack (underutilized resources), fiscal multipliers may be larger and crowding out smaller.
- In full-employment settings, fiscal expansion may push interest rates up and crowd out investment.
You should be able to articulate both sides.
2.2 Monetary Policy: Interest Rates, Money, Credit, and Expectations
Monetary policy definition
Monetary policy is conducted by a central bank to influence:
- interest rates,
- money/credit conditions,
- and ultimately inflation and economic activity.
In many macro courses, the policy lever is framed as a change in:
- the policy interest rate or related rates.
Transmission channels (must know)
A strong exam response includes multiple channels:
- Interest rate channel
- Higher policy rates → higher borrowing costs → lower consumption and investment.
- Exchange rate channel
- Higher interest rates → attracts foreign capital → currency appreciates → imported inflation decreases.
- Asset price / wealth channel
- Changes in interest rates alter valuation of assets; affects household wealth and spending.
- Credit channel
- Banks’ willingness and ability to lend can change with policy rates and risk conditions.
- Expectations channel
- If credibility is strong, credible inflation targeting can anchor expectations.
- If credibility is weak, policy tightening may not fully reduce inflation expectations.
Examiners often reward students who mention expectations, especially when discussing inflation persistence.
2.3 Exchange Rates and Inflation Pass-Through
In an open economy, exchange rates affect inflation via import prices.
How depreciation can raise inflation
- Depreciation → imports become more expensive (in local currency)
- Firms pass on some of these higher costs to prices (not always fully or immediately)
- Inflation rises—sometimes with lag.
How appreciation can reduce inflation
- Appreciation → imported inputs cheaper
- Lower cost pressure → inflation falls (with lag).
This mechanism is crucial in South Africa-focused scenarios because:
- fuel and many inputs may be import-dependent,
- exchange-rate movements can create inflation volatility.

2.5 Short-Run vs Long-Run Policy Outcomes
In short run:
- policy affects output (real variables) and inflation.
In long run:
- classical/long-run view emphasizes that output returns to potential due to flexible prices/wages or adjustment dynamics.
- inflation adjusts based on monetary/fiscal stance and expectations.
A “high marks” approach: explicitly state what can and cannot be permanently affected.
What policy can’t do easily:
- Permanently raise output above potential without changes in productive capacity.
- Reduce unemployment below its natural/structural level sustainably unless labour market conditions improve.
What policy can do:
- Stabilize business cycles.
- Influence inflation trend and expectations.
- Support investment conditions (indirectly via interest rate stability and credibility).
2.6 Worked Policy Transmission Example (Step-by-Step)
Scenario: The central bank decides to raise the policy interest rate due to rising inflation.
Step-by-step transmission:
- Policy rate increases.
- Bank lending rates rise.
- Households face higher mortgage/loan repayments → consumption growth slows.
- Firms face higher borrowing costs → investment declines.
- Aggregate demand falls → GDP growth slows.
- Demand falls reduce pricing pressure → inflation gradually declines.
- If credibility is strong, expectations anchor and inflation may decline faster.
- If currency appreciates, imported inflation falls too, accelerating disinflation.
What could go wrong (counter-arguments):
- If inflation expectations remain unanchored, inflation may be “sticky.”
- If supply shocks dominate (e.g., energy price spike), contractionary policy might not stop inflation fully.
- Credit constraints can weaken the transmission: if banks are reluctant to lend due to risk, consumption may already be weak and monetary policy may have uneven effects.
2.7 Fiscal-Monetary Coordination: Why It Matters
Policy credibility depends on consistency. If government increases spending aggressively while monetary policy tightens:
- long-run inflation expectations can be higher if markets anticipate inflationary financing.
- interest rates could rise anyway, possibly increasing debt servicing costs.
If fiscal is disciplined while monetary targets inflation:
- policy credibility improves.
- long-run inflation expectations can be better anchored.
Exam answers that mention coordination typically score higher because they go beyond “raise rates to reduce inflation” and show policy interactions.

3.5 Labour Markets in Macro: Unemployment Types and Output Gaps
Unemployment and macro conditions
Unemployment changes over the business cycle, but not only due to demand:
- cyclical unemployment rises when output falls below potential.
- structural unemployment relates to skill mismatch, labour market rigidities, and changing economic structure.
Some courses also discuss:
- frictional unemployment (job search time).
A high-quality answer will classify the type:
- “If an economy’s output falls sharply, what happens?” → cyclical rise likely.
- “If skills don’t match new industries, what happens?” → structural persistence.
Unemployment and output gap
In many models:
- When output is below potential, firms hire fewer workers → unemployment rises.
- When output is above potential, unemployment tends to fall.
3.6 Inflation-Unemployment Trade-off: Conceptual Phillips Curve Logic
Even without deep formal derivations, you should understand the intuition:
- When unemployment is low and demand high, inflation may increase.
- When unemployment is high, inflation may fall.
However, modern interpretations emphasize that:
- inflation depends on expectations,
- and supply shocks can shift inflation even if unemployment is stable.
Exam-friendly nuance:
- If inflation rises due to supply shocks, unemployment may rise too (stagflation-type scenario).
3.7 Short-Run vs Long-Run Unemployment Behaviour
A typical macro question asks about:
- why unemployment cannot be permanently held below its “natural rate” without accelerating inflation.
Core reasoning:
- workers and firms adjust expectations,
- wages adjust,
- so the initial relationship between low unemployment and low inflation weakens.
This is often used to explain why policymakers face trade-offs:
- stabilize inflation quickly but accept higher short-run unemployment,
- or tolerate higher inflation for lower short-run unemployment.
3.8 Worked Example: Combining Money Market and AD Effects
Scenario: The central bank lowers interest rates during a recession.
Transmission through money and credit:
- Policy rate decreases.
- Market interest rates decrease.
- Borrowers face lower financing costs.
- Investment and interest-sensitive consumption rise.
- AD shifts right.
- Output increases and unemployment falls.
Counter-argument scenario:
- If inflation expectations increase or risk perceptions rise, banks may not pass through lower rates.
- If households fear job losses, consumption may not rise even if rates fall.
- Therefore, monetary easing can have weaker effects if confidence/credit constraints are severe.

4.4 Depreciation: Effects and Ambiguities
Depreciation can improve the trade balance over time because:
- exports become cheaper for foreign buyers,
- imports become more expensive for domestic buyers.
But short-run effects can be ambiguous due to:
- contracts fixed in foreign currency,
- import demand being inelastic in the short run,
- pass-through into inflation increasing costs and reducing competitiveness.
This nuance is essential. Examiners often mark off overly simplistic responses like “depreciation always improves the trade balance.”

4.6 Worked Example: Exchange Rate Shock and Domestic Policy Response
Scenario: A country experiences a currency depreciation due to reduced capital inflows.
Short-run effects:
- Imported goods become more expensive.
- Inflation rises via import price pass-through.
- Household purchasing power falls → consumption declines.
- Higher inflation may increase wage demands and pricing.
Policy response options:
- Monetary policy may tighten to reduce inflation and prevent unanchored expectations.
- Fiscal policy could be either:
- constrained due to higher debt service costs,
- or temporarily supportive if government has fiscal capacity and focuses on targeted relief.
Exam-ready evaluation:
- Tightening can stabilize inflation but may increase unemployment short-run.
- Loose fiscal expansion may worsen inflation expectations and debt sustainability.
A top answer weighs both effects and explicitly links them to unemployment and output.
